The Magic Compass is a recurring Item in The Legend of Zelda series.[name references needed]

Locations and Uses

The Legend of Zelda (TV Series)

The Magic Compass is only seen in the "Underworld Connections" episode of the "The Legend of Zelda TV series. It is used to locate the remaining shards of the Triforce of Wisdom.[1]

When Vires manage to split the Triforce of Wisdom into three Shards, Link is able to grab one Triforce Shard while the remaining two go at the hands of the Vires. However, Link shoots a Sword Beam at the shard that they possess, which defeats the Vires that were carrying the other two pieces into the Underworld.[2] Using the Magic Compass, Link and Princess Zelda venture into the underground to locate the two Triforce Shard that were dropped by the Vires and thus reunite the Triforce of Wisdom.

The Legend of Zelda (Valiant Comics)

The Magic Compass is used to locate the Triforce of Wisdom in The Legend of Zelda comics by Valiant Comics.[3][4] In "Missing in Action", Link uses the Magic Compass to track Princess Zelda, who has taken the Triforce of Wisdom to leave Hyrule forever and thus impede Ganon from ever obtaining it. Link uses the Magic Compass once again in Queen of Hearts when the Triforce of Wisdom is stolen, which leads them to find out that Queen Seline took it.
